Alarm & Chime Set On/Off
Wecker und Chime Ein-/Aus- stellen

Starting in normal display mode, While Holding RESET_knob in continuously, push START_knob 1 to 4 times to select through 4 successive variations of:
  • Alarm On , Chime Off
  • Alarm On , Chime On
  • Alarm Off, Chime On
  • Alarm Off, Chime Off
Note 1 push of START_knob does not necessarily put watch on 1st line, it merely moves watch on 1 state from previous state.

Timer Mode (eg Stop Watch for sprint runners etc)
Chronograph-Betrieb

  • In normal time display mode, Push RESET_knob to enter time mode.
    In der Normal- zeit : Druck Knopf_Mode, um Chronograph Funktion ein- zu- stellen.
  • START_knob starts & stops timer, running in hundredths of a second. It adds cumulative sessions.
    Start/Stop : Knopf_Start Drucken. Die Zahlung erfolgt in Hundert- stel Sekunden
  • RESET_knob resets to zero.
    Zeit- ablauf- messung : Wahrend der Chronograph- Zeit- anzeige und Wahrend der Chronograph Zahlung durch Druck auf Knopf_Reset auf Zeit- ablauf- messung (Messung Verbrauchter Zeit) umstellen. Der Chronograph Zahlt nach der Umstellung ungehindert weiter.
  • MODE_knob escapes from time mode.
    Nochmals Knopf_Reset drucken, um wieder auf Chronograph- Zeit- anzeige um- zu- stellen.
  • If you escape from time mode back to normal time display mode, without stopping the timer, the timer continues to run

Setting Normal Time
Ein- Stellen der Normal- zeit

To Get Here on Digi-tech
Hold MODE_knob for 3 seconds. Release. Push MODE_knob briefly.
Fest- halten Knopf_Mode 3 Sekunde und Knopf_Mode drucken
To Get Here on Kenko, simpler see above.
Next:
  • The seconds blink. Push RESET_knob to zero it.
    Die Sekunden- stellen blinken auf. Bei Druck auf Knopf_Reset stellen sich die Sekunden auf Null zuruck.
    Kenko: push START_knob to zero the seconds, push RESET_knob to move to minutes.

  • Push START_knob. The minutes blink, & can be incremented by RESET_knob
    1 mal Knopf_Start drucken : die zweite Stelle der Minuten blinkt und kann mittel Knopf_Reset verstellt werden.
    Push Start knob to increment minutes, (or hold in hard to scroll fast); Push RESET_knob to move to Hours.

  • Push START_knob again. The hours blink, & can be incremented by RESET_knob
    2 mal Knopf_Start drucken : die Stunden- stelle blinkt und kann wie oben verstellt werden.

    Kenko: Push START_knob to rotate through hours (you have a choice of 12 or 24 hour display): Hours show as 0H -> 23H, 12A, 1A -> 11A, 12P, 1P -> 11P. Push RESET_knob to move to move to date (day in month).

  • Push START_knob again. The day in month blinks on right, & can be incremented by RESET_knob
    3 mal Knopf_Start drucken : die Monat- stelle blinkt und kann wie oben verstellt werden.
    Kenko: Push START_knob to rotate through date (day in month). Push RESET_knob to move to day in week.

  • Push START_knob again. The month blinks on left, & can be incremented by RESET_knob
    4 mal Knopf_Start drucken : die Datum- stelle blinkt und kann wie oben verstellt werden.
    Kenko: Push START_knob to rotate through month. Push RESET_knob to move to day in week.

  • Push START_knob again. The day in week blinks, & can be incremented by RESET_knob
    5 mal Knopf_Start drucken : die Wochen- tag- anzeiger blink und kann wie oben verstellt werden.
    Kenko: Push START_knob to rotate through day in week (Su - Sa) . Push RESET_knob to return to setting seconds, Or, Push MODE_knob to finish setting time.
START_knob continues to select & RESET_knob to {zero seconds or increment other settings}, until you push MODE_knob to escape to normal time display mode.

Setting 12 or 24 Hour Mode
12/24- Stunden- Anzeige- format zur Wahl

Hold RESET_knob pressed continuously, (Main display then shows: "12 00 p") & pulse MODE_knob, observe on left side in middle height, a tiny PM logo on the left goes On & Off (so tiny it needs either bright sunlight, or a magnifying glass. & the "P" can fall into shadow of edge of display if office window on wrong side.), If the PM symbol shows, before releasing RESET_knob, then display after is in 24 hour format, not 12 hour.
